The Position
Executive Branch Auditors plan, organize and conduct comprehensive reviews of programs and activities of executive branch agencies in accordance with the standards of the Institute of Internal Auditors.
Incumbents possess a degree of knowledge and proficiency sufficient to perform advanced-level work and may provide work direction and training to others.
This position is located within the Internal Audits Division of the Governor's Finance Office in Carson City. Auditors conduct reviews on internal controls and accounts, records, activities, and operations of State agencies to ensure compliance with State and federal rules and regulations and legal requirements and/or proper safeguarding of agency funds. The position also reviews contracts and grants for compliance with State and federal guidelines. To Qualify:
In order to be qualified, you must meet the following requirements:
Education and Experience (Minimum Qualifications)
Current licensure as a Certified Public Accountant (CPA) and two years of professional level auditing experience; OR a Master's degree from an accredited college or university in business administration, accounting, finance or closely related field and three years of professional auditing experience. At least one year of the experience must have included compliance, financial or performance audits; OR current certification as a Certified Internal Auditor and three years of professional auditing experience in compliance, financial, or performance audits or reviews; OR one year of experience as an Executive Branch Auditor I in Nevada State service to include the above detailed education and/or certification.
Special Requirements
Proof of a valid driver's license or evidence of equivalent mobility is required at the time of appointment and as a condition of continued employment.
